Output 1291602b115b7a233652a025457fac9dc6f8970be2493135f027f9ee5f80ddea:1

value
975420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d465399df8121e6c5bcc904d53f05ddb1cc74a98 OP_EQUAL
address
3M44STDFq85eYN1nrJqPVaxYFb9SpuZhv6
transaction
1291602b115b7a233652a025457fac9dc6f8970be2493135f027f9ee5f80ddea
spent
true